Dr. Avul Pakir Jainulabhudin Adbul Kalam, the twelfth President of India, is rightfully termed as the father of India's missile technology. He was born to parents Jainulabdeen Marakayar and Ashiamma on 15th October, 1931, at Dhanushkodi in Rameshwaram district, Tamil Nadu.

Dr. A.P.J. Abdul Kalam, the former President of India and renowned aerospace scientist, worked under rigorous conditions throughout his career. He was known for his disciplined work ethic, often spending long hours at laboratories and institutions like ISRO and DRDO, where he contributed to India's missile and space programs. Despite facing challenges, including limited resources and tight deadlines, he remained dedicated to his vision of a self-reliant India in science and technology. His inspiring leadership and commitment to education and innovation significantly influenced India's scientific landscape.
